On the obverse of 2022 1 oz Silver Taekwondo Medals the Taegeuk is depicted. Central to this Korean emblem is the symbol of Yin and Yang, which is an essential part of Eastern philosophy and thought. You will also note on this symbol is the medal’s latent security feature. Additional obverse details include a swirling line pattern and inscriptions reading Korea, 2022.

The reverse side of 2022 South Korean Taekwondo Medals features a Taekwondo martial artist in action. Here, the fighter is in front-facing position as he strikes an intimidating pose. This is brand-new artwork and fits nicely alongside the previous designs in the Taekwondo collection. The reverse also features the image of a fist breaking through a wall along with the identifying hallmarks.

Korea Minting and Security Printing Corporation, or KOMSCO, was established in 1951 during the Korean War. The mint offers numerous exciting bullion collections, including the K-Series. Launched in 2019, this series has featured 4 different designs centered on the martial art known as Taekwondo. BU and Proof versions are available in silver. A gold BU edition is also produced.
